Best for self-contained campers. There are no toilets, showers, or potable water at this Hipcamp.
🌿 The Vale — Creekside Escape in Nature’s Quiet Tucked just above a gently flowing creek in picturesque Middle Pocket, The Vale is your perfect retreat for disconnecting and soaking in raw natural beauty. Wide flat spaces, forest whispers, and the gentle murmur of water set the mood for camping that feels like stepping into a dream. What You’ll Love • Spacious creekside site with room to breathe—plenty of flat area just above the creek, perfect for tents, campers, or groups. • Campfires welcome—gather around the flames under star-strewn skies and let the evening hush you in. • Pet friendly and off-leash allowed—bring your furry friends and let them roam safely in this quiet, shaded haven. Please make sure your pets don't bother the cattle. • Self-contained camping—without toilets, showers, or potable water, this is your chance to fully unplug and get immersive.
